Proposed Agenda for Second Week of the
International Workshop on Total Diet Studies

 

Afternoon: Laboratory demonstrations

Each participant will have the opportunity to attend four of the six lab sessions listed below. Attendance will be limited to 15 people per laboratory.

Sample Preparation and Carbamates

P&IC analysis of fatty and non-fatty foods

Minerals and Hydride operations

Mercury analysis and Furnace operations

VOCs, CPAs

ETU, Benzimidazoles, Phenylureas

Morning: Laboratory lectures at the hotel

Up to five lecture/discussions will be offered each morning depending on attendee interest.

Participants will be able to attend a lecture session corresponding to the laboratory session which they are scheduled to attend in the afternoon. These sessions will focus on the procedures to be demonstrated in the corresponding laboratories. Topics will include procedural overview, theory, and problems. Historical findings and trends will also be discussed.

Optional lecture sessions will also be provided in the morning sessions:

Quality assurance principles/problem

Scope of analyses, foods, elements, P&ICs

Future developments and research
